‘Tyres’ to get back insaddle for NW ‘CycleAgainst Suicide’

‘Tyres O’Flaherty’ is looking forward to cycling from Strabane to Londonderry and back next Saturday (August 6) in aid of the Cycling Against Suicide charity.

Holywood-actor Michael Smiley - who first rose to prominence when he appeared as the rave-loving cycling courier alongside Simon Pegg and Nick Frost in ‘Spaced’ - says he’s really looking forward to supporting such a good cause.

“It will be a real honour to ride with yiz,” he remarked via social media. “This is such an important charity.”

Following his breakthrough in ‘Spaced,’ Mr Smiley went on to appear in over a dozen well known British series, as wells as feature films such as ‘Shaun of the Dead,’ ‘Perfume,’ ‘Burke and Hare,’ and ‘Kill List.’

Cycle Against Suicide is a voluntary organisation that aims to: raise awareness; offer reassurance that it’s OK not to feel OK and to ask for help; and to direct people towards critical help if necessary.

Its motto is that “Together, shoulder to shoulder, we can Break the Cycle of Suicide on the island of Ireland!”

The organisers of the Londonderry cycle stated: “This Spin Off will be a first for another reason as we have Michael Smiley, comedian, actor and avid cyclist cycling the Spin Off with us.

“This Spin Off gives us a great opportunity to get our message out in Northern Ireland.”

The cycle will start at the Fire station on Railway street in Strabane at 2pm travelling to Londonderry and, after a short break, returning to Strabane by 5pm.
